A Little History
Fred Waring had a program in the 1930's and would do an arrangement for a
fight song for a university for the most signatures that week....Sooner faithful
rose to the challenge and here is that arrangement. The song debuted on
The Chesterfield Hour. Here the original December 1, 1939 broadcast
premiere of O.K. Oklahoma, as performed by Waring's Pennsylvanians and
arranged by Oklahoma native Lara Hoggard.

Trivia - as promised - The
Yell
Apparently when OU had one of it's first football games and debates, they
needed a yell. Kansas State ain't got nothing on this yell!!!
Hi rickety
whoop-te-do
Boomer
Sooner, Okla-U!,
Hi rickety whoop-te-do
Boomer Sooner, Okla-U!,
